Alipay
Alipay is a Chinese mobile payment and digital wallet platform that also provides access to everyday services such as ride-hailing, food delivery, and utility bill payments.
It supports international credit and debit card linking, QR code payments, the contactless Alipay Tap! feature using NFC, palm scanning and facial recognition, and an AI assistant for voice-based service discovery.

What is the company behind Alipay?
Alipay is owned by Alibaba Group Holding Limited, headquartered in Hangzhou, China.
